Receives light minutes in return Dieng (calf) tallied three points (1-1 FG, 1-1 3Pt) and one assist across seven minutes in Friday's 117-116 win over the Grizzlies.
Impact Available to play for the first time since Dec. 19 following a 10-game absence due to a right calf strain, Dieng was needed to round out the Oklahoma City rotation while the Thunder were without seven players due to injury. Most of Dieng's appearances this season have come at the end of blowout games or when the Thunder have been down multiple key rotation pieces, so he could see his minutes disappear in Sunday's game against the Heat if one or more of Shai Gilgeous-Alexander (ankle), Chet Holmgren (shins) and Cason Wallace (toe) return to action after sitting out Friday.

Hits four triples in win Dieng chipped in 14 points (5-7 FG, 4-5 3Pt), two rebounds and three assists across 26 minutes during Sunday's 131-101 win over the Jazz.
Impact Dieng hit season highs in points and minutes played, and was likely in for extended run due to the blowout nature of the game. Dieng is not expected to be a regular rotation player for Oklahoma City, but if he is able to turn in efficient minutes like he did Sunday, he may be able to work his way up the depth chart.

Game-high 17 points Friday Dieng tallied 17 points (6-12 FG, 2-7 3Pt, 3-4 FT), four rebounds, one assist, one steal and one block over 20 minutes during Friday's 94-91 preseason win over Denver.
Impact Dieng ended the preseason on a high note by leading both teams in scoring Friday. The 2022 first-rounder logged double-digit points in four of six exhibition contests, though he connected on just 33.8 percent of his field-goal attempts. Dieng averaged 10.9 minutes per game while appearing in 37 regular-season contests (one start) during the 2024-25 campaign, and he figures to see a similar role off the bench for the upcoming season.

Fills stat sheet in win Dieng recorded 17 points (7-14 FG, 3-6 3Pt), eight rebounds, six assists and one steal across 33 minutes of Sunday's 135-114 preseason win over Charlotte.
Impact With the Thunder resting their usual starters, Dieng drew the starting nod and operated as a primary option on offense along with Aaron Wiggins. Dieng has been used sparingly by the Thunder for the past three season, as he holds career regular-season averages of 4.3 points, 2.2 rebounds and 1.0 assists in 12.3 minutes. If Sunday was any indication, he looks hungry to earn more minutes.
